Revealed: Germany Packaging Material Market Poised for Significant Growth by 2035

The latest insights indicate that the Germany packaging material market is on a remarkable growth path, expected to reach approximately $51.4 billion by 2035. Growing at a CAGR of 3.04%, this market is witnessing unprecedented shifts driven by evolving consumer preferences and heightened sustainability regulations. The demand for innovative packaging solutions is surging, particularly as e-commerce becomes increasingly prevalent and brands strive to distinguish themselves in a competitive landscape.

As we delve into the specifics, the Germany packaging material market reveals diverse segments and dynamic trends that are shaping its future. In 2024, the market is projected to register a value of around $34.58 billion, reflecting the growing emphasis on sustainable and customizable packaging solutions. A thorough examination of the key players in the Germany packaging material market indicates a highly competitive environment featuring several prominent companies. Notable names such as Amcor, Sealed Air, and Mondi are at the forefront, continually innovating to meet the rising consumer demands for eco-friendly options. Ball Corporation and WestRock are also vital in advancing packaging solutions that align with sustainability initiatives. Examining the regional dynamics reveals that different segments of the Germany packaging material market are experiencing distinct growth trajectories. The flexible packaging segment is particularly noteworthy, gaining traction due to its lightweight nature and versatility in e-commerce applications. This segment is projected to continue its upward trend, significantly influencing overall market dynamics. On the other hand, rigid packaging remains essential, particularly in sectors such as food and beverage, where safety and preservation are top priorities.

Moreover, the paperboard packaging segment is emerging as a preferred choice among environmentally conscious consumers and businesses. The demand for sustainable packaging is driving innovation within this segment, leading to a greater emphasis on producing materials that can be recycled or reused.
